titleOfInvention Variable pH value, liquid material reformer
abstract P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: Conventionally, with respect to the electronic hydrogen ion concentration PH value of water or liquid, the normal ion concentration has been modified, but the maximum is about 14 or 2 in the alkali direction. It was a problem to reach a concentration range that makes use of further ion concentration, that is, sterilization characteristics by alkaline water. Furthermore, the problem to acidification remained. [MEANS FOR SOLVING PROBLEMS] A metal grid is appropriately provided inside a reformer, an appropriate frequency is determined, a circulation type electronic circuit and a shower spray device are added, and an electric shock prevention measure by charging is applied to the circulation circuit. The solution was a simple circuit with increased amplification energy and a cooler added to stabilize the product to be generated. [Selection] Figure 1
